Emotions are all functions of the ways in which external things affect our powers or capacities. Joy is simply the movement to a greater capacity for action. Sadness is the passage to a lesser state of perfection. Love is nothing but joy accompanied by awareness of an external cause. Hate is sadness with the accompanying idea of an external cause. Hope and fear are inconstant joy or sadness arisen from the image of a future we doubt. When a doubtful outcome becomes probable, hope is changed into confidence, while fear is changed into despair.
